If you buy or sell loose cigarettes you will have to pay a fine of $12,000 and be imprisoned for 6 months.

Speaking in debate in the senate, Opposition senator Wade Mark slammed this prohibition. THis is Draconian Legislation. It is legislation to imprison and kidnap the ordinary member of the population. How could it be a criminal offence for a small owner of a parlour to retail one cigarette to an ordinary member of the public? "So u can sell me a pack to smoke myself to death, but not one or two cigarettes he added.

Mark said, if someone was trying to kick the smoking habit by buying cigarettes one at a time, the bill would be discouraging this, and doing the exact opposite of what is was intended to do, which is to curb the use of tobacco.

He added that with many people working for a $9 a day minimum wage, they could not afford to buy cigarettes by the packs, but only singly and this practice was very prevalent at the grassroot level of society.

"When i tell people about this bill, they cannot believe that there is a bill before parliament banning poor people from buying one cigarette", Mark said. :?

All the tobacco companies have to do is wrap singles in a plastic bag or something and call it a product.

According to Clause 31 (2): ’No person shall sell single cigarettes or other smoked tobacco products, or sell any smoked tobacco product other than as part of a complete and intact package that meets minimum quantity requirements. Clause 31 (3) A person who contravenes this section commits an offence and is liable on summary conviction to a fine of $12,000 and to imprisonment for six months’.

However,

Government wrapped up debate on the bill after it became clear that it was not going to get the requisite support needed to pass the special majority legislation. Independent Senators each expressed problems with different clauses in the bill.
